The impact you'll makeAt Lam, as a Strategic Commodity Manager, you play a crucial role in managing industry suppliers. You'll develop and implement commodity strategies, align development deliverables, benchmark suppliers, negotiate agreements, and resolve delivery, cost, and production challenges. Navigating a highly visible and dynamic environment, your strategic expertise in implementing initiatives will support commodity availability, quality, and cost to maintain Lam's reliability and competitive edge.
What you'll do- Develop, align, and implement commodity strategy.
- Understand the commodity landscape in order to forecast industry trends and gauge emerging competitive forces.
- Negotiate, manage, and maintain supplier agreements that provide optimal terms.
- Direct new supplier engagement and/or disengagement requirements to the Lam supply base.
- Collaborate across the Lam organization to ensure business objectives are met.
- Identify potential supply issues and communicate findings to senior leaders.
- Drive resolution of systemic supply chain issues affecting cost, delivery, quality, service, and development support.
- Optimize supply chain/supplier performance through cost, capacity scenario analysis, and benchmarking.

Lam offers a variety of work location models based on the needs of each role. Our hybrid roles combine the benefits of on-site collaboration with colleagues and the flexibility to work remotely and fall into two categories - On-site Flex and Virtual Flex. 'On-site Flex' you'll work 3+ days per week on-site at a Lam or customer/supplier location, with the opportunity to work remotely for the balance of the week. 'Virtual Flex' you'll work 1-2 days per week on-site at a Lam or customer/supplier location, and remotely the rest of the time.
